ISSUES POSSIBLE CAUSES SOLUTIONS
Steam is not coming out of
the Steam Nozzles
Improper Handle Assembly Call Customer Service to receive instruc ons to correct
the problem
The Hard Surface Floor Pad
is not adhering to Steamer
Not enough pressure was
applied when a aching Pad
Posi on Steamer about 2” above Pad and FIRMLY press
it down onto the Pad
Floor Pad requires replacing
due to age of the Floor Pad
Replacement Floor Pads can be purchased at most
electrical appliance retail outlets
The Cleaning Pads are
ge ng soaked (too wet).
Why?
Boiler is overfi lled Let Steamer run un l excess water ceases. -OR- Remove
some water from Boiler once the Boiler has cooled
down completely
Green “Steam Ready Indica-
tor Light” is not illuminated
Wait for green “Steam Ready Indicator Light” to
illuminate
The steam seems to be
making my fl oor too wet
Front Steam Jets are being
used too frequently
Only use Front Steam Jets in short bursts for cleaning
tougher dirt or to clean hard to reach areas
The Cleaning Pad is too wet
(saturated with moisture)
Replace the wet Pad with a dry, clean Pad and con nue
cleaning
